Abstract:
A dynamic pressure in the coolant supplied between a rotating grinding wheel and a rotating workpiece is released by making at least one of oblique grooves on the grinding wheel pass vertically through a contact surface on which a grinding surface of the grinding wheel contacts the workpiece. Where one and the other side intersection points are defined as intersection points at which both ends of each oblique groove respectively cross extension lines of one and the other side edges parallel to a grinding wheel circumferential direction of the contact surface, the other side intersection point of each oblique groove overlaps the one side intersection point of an oblique groove next to each such oblique groove by a predetermined overlap amount in the grinding wheel circumferential direction, and the length in the grinding wheel circumferential direction of the contact surface is made to be shorter than the overlap amount.
